Big Bang Releases First Official Japanese Photobook


Big Bang has been met with great success this year in Japan after their 2009 debut. Along with many events, tv appearances and showcases, the group will be releasing their first official photobook based on their 2010 Electric Love Tour.

“We hope people will be able to understand what we think about a little more deeply,” leader G-Dragon shared on his thoughts about the photobook. With a total of 354 images in 208 pages, the photbook will follow the boys from their stay in Japan during the six concerts they held earlier this year in Tokyo, Yokohama, and Kobe.

Titled Big Bang Presents Electric Love Tour 2010, the book went to the #19th place on Amazon on the 29th. The book will also include exclusive interviews and the member’s thoughts on each other, which fans are looking forward to.

To celebrate the release of the photobook, Big Bang will be holding a hand-shaking event on the 31st of October in Tokyo. After having 30,000 fans attend their concerts, it’s no surprise that the 15,000 tickets for the special event sold out quickly after their initial sale on the 28th.
